APH vs CLS

Amphenol and Celestica Inc., both Technology

Amphenol is the larger company at $202B against $43B. On trailing earnings CLS is the cheaper of the two at a P/E of 37.2 against 40.4, a gap that is only a bargain if the two are growing at similar rates. Over the past year CLS returned +53% against +48% for APH. Ryufin's sector-relative Smart Score puts APH ahead, 9/10 against 8/10.

Amphenol

Revenue of $8.8B in Q2 2026, net income $1.8B. Its largest reported line is Communications Solutions, 59% of the disclosed total.

Celestica Inc.

Revenue of $4.0B in Q1 2026, net income $212M. Its largest reported line is CCS, 75% of the disclosed total.
